What is a senior full stack developer?

Senior Full Stack Developers are experienced professionals who design, develop, and maintain both the front-end and back-end components of web applications. They are proficient in multiple programming languages and frameworks, enabling them to handle servers, databases, APIs, and user interfaces. In addition to coding, they often lead development teams, make architectural decisions, and ensure software quality and scalability. Their expertise allows them to oversee the entire application lifecycle, from concept to deployment.

What is the difference between Senior Full Stack Developer vs Backend Developer?

AspectSenior Full Stack DeveloperBackend Developer
Required SkillsProficiency in both frontend and backend technologies, such as JavaScript, HTML, CSS, and server-side languages like Node.js, Python, or JavaSpecialized in server-side development, working with languages like Java, Python, Ruby, or PHP, and database management
Work EnvironmentCollaborates across frontend and backend teams, often involved in full project lifecycleFocuses primarily on backend systems, APIs, and database integration
Common UsageUsed in roles requiring full project oversight and versatile development skillsUsed in roles focused on server-side logic, database management, and API development

The main difference is that a Senior Full Stack Developer handles both frontend and backend development, providing a comprehensive approach to projects, while a Backend Developer specializes solely in server-side logic and database management. Both roles require strong programming skills, but the Full Stack Developer's expertise spans the entire technology stack.

Job Summary
The Senior Mine Engineer (Long Range) is responsible for developing, maintaining, and optimizing the Life of Mine (LOM) plans and designs for Kinross Nevada open-pit operations. This role ensures long-term strategic plans are economically optimized, safe, and compliant with geotechnical and environmental standards. They work closely with technical services, geology, and site management to maximize shareholder value and operational performance. Qualified candidates may be eligible for both a sign-on bonus and relocation assistance.
Key Responsibilities
1. Strategic Mine Planning: Run pit optimizations and support mineral inventory reporting requirements, optimize mine plans, fleet sizing studies, create stack plans, and technical studies focused on asset optimization.
2. Design And Modelling: Create open pits, waste rock dumps, haul roads and stormwater drainages. Able to check block models using drill data, run statistics and create scripts preferred.
3. Scheduling and Economic Analysis: Integrates short-term plans into long-term, and life-of-mine plans. Perform excel level economic analysis. Support feasibility studies (NI 43-101) as required.
4. Reconciliation and Compliance: Analyzes and interprets mine plans to ensure alignment with financial, environmental and operational objectives. Perform reconciliation of actuals vs. planned production, updating plans to reflect reality while maximizing NPV.
5. Collaboration: Work with short range planners, environmental, exploration, metallurgy, geotech, maintenance, and leadership teams to ensure long term plans are technically sound.
6. Innovation: Researches information to support decision-making and improve processes, technologies or methodologies.
7. Safety and Mentorship: Contributes to safety culture, and the development of policies and practices. Must be willing to take on cross-rotation assignments within the Technical Services Group for personal development.
